Judge Issues Order Regarding Plant Board

On June 9th, Arkansas Circuit Court Judge Chip Welch issued a written order in regards to a lawsuit filed against the State Plant Board challenging the constitutionality of the section of the law establishing the composition of the board. The order concluded that certain board positions where appointments made by the Governor from a limited pool of nominees is deemed unconstitutional as an unconstitutional delegation of public power to private interests, in which the order cited articles 2, 4, and 5, of the State Constitution. The order noted that the decision was governed by a 2021 decision by the State Supreme Court related to the previous statute governing the State Plant Board. The order also declared those seats to be vacant as did the 2021 decision by the State Supreme Court.
